Two New York Times reporters break one of the most important stories in a generation—a story that helped launch the #MeToo movement and shattered decades of silence in Hollywood.

As the camera lingers on the dreadful scenes of an abuser’s hotel room, women’s voices fill the space he once inhabited. Survivors become bigger, louder, and more powerful, with their own enduring cinematic legacy.
